Binding blade gets my vote. Dragon effectiveness, QR5, 16 might, 4/4 defenses when attacked is a bit loaded for a weapon. Though there are a few that contest it.

IMO, it's any Falchion. The variety of stat bonuses and effects makes the user more versatile and flexible.
For example, the Bond/Sealed Falchion users can be dragon-slayers, combat medics, defensive tanks, offensive sweepers, etc. given the right build.

Ares's Dark Mystletainn get a feature here because of how underrated the weapon is. Ares is the only unit capable of endless looping AOE specials after the first activation. (-1 from attack, -2 from after battle, with slaying edge effect), which makes him a monster capable of killing more high defense blues(since AOE's ignore WTA).

I actually answered Dark Mystletainn the last time this question was asked, but it's not so special now. Anyone with special spiral and either slaying weapon or heavy blade seal can do infinite AoE specials. Ophelia can do it and also have it charged immediately on turn 1.

Ares/Eldigan are the only units that can do the vantage build though.
